Some provinces let students stay home from school to avoid the storm

NHÓM PV |

The tropical depression has strengthened into storm number 4, and affected provinces in the North Central region have allowed students to stay home from school to avoid the storm.

Educational institutions in Quang Binh proactively let students stay home from school

On September 19, the Department of Education and Training of Quang Binh province said that to ensure the safety of students, administrators, teachers, and staff, educational institutions are required to proactively let students take time off from school based on the actual situation. At the same time, they should focus on flood prevention work, and not be subjective or negligent.

Areas at risk of flash floods, landslides, and deep flooding during heavy rains should proactively move machinery, teaching equipment, documents, and records to higher floors or to places without the risk of flooding to avoid property damage. Develop a plan to ensure the safety of teachers and students when going to school, especially in low-lying areas.

Do mua lon, nhieu tuyen duong tai TP Dong Hoi (Quang Binh) bi ngap ung trong sang 19.9. Anh: Cong Sang
Due to heavy rain, many roads in Dong Hoi City (Quang Binh) were flooded on the morning of September 19. Photo: Cong Sang

It is forecasted that today (September 19) to the night of September 20, in the Quang Binh area, there is a possibility of heavy rain, some places with very heavy rain. The focus of heavy rain is from September 19-20. The total specific rainfall is as follows: Tuyen Hoa and Minh Hoa districts from 130-280mm, some places over 380mm; Quang Trach districts, Ba Don town, Bo Trach, Dong Hoi city from 140-290mm, some places over 390mm; Quang Ninh and Le Thuy districts from 150-300mm, some places over 400mm.

Heavy rains are likely to cause flash floods and landslides in Tuyen Hoa and Minh Hoa districts; mountainous areas of Bo Trach, Quang Trach, Quang Ninh and Le Thuy districts. Flooding in low-lying areas, riverside areas; urban areas.

Dong Hoi City urgently lets students stay home from school

On the morning of September 19, the Department of Education and Training of Dong Hoi City (Quang Binh Province) announced that it had just issued an urgent dispatch allowing students to stay home from school from the afternoon of the same day.

Accordingly, to cope with storm No. 4 and heavy rain, students in Dong Hoi City will be off from school from this afternoon (September 19) until further notice. The school will have a normal lunch from 11:00-11:30, parents can pick up their children before or after lunch.

According to Lao Dong Newspaper, at 8:45 a.m. on September 19, in Dong Hoi City, wind began to appear and rain fell in waves.

On Vo Thi Sau Street (Dong Hoi City), a tree was uprooted and lying across the road. Authorities came to trim the branches.

On the morning of September 19, some roads in Dong Hoi City (Quang Binh) were partially flooded due to heavy rain.

Students in Thua Thien Hue province stay home from school to avoid storm No. 4

Accordingly, implementing the direction of the Provincial People's Committee, the Department of Education and Training of Thua Thien Hue province announces: The Departments of Education and Training, Vocational Education and Training Centers and units under the Department of Education and Training notify all teachers and students to take a day off on September 19 to prevent storms and floods.

After Thua Thien Hue province decided to announce that students in the entire province would be off school, at around 5:10 a.m. on September 19, the tropical depression strengthened into storm No. 4, about 200km east of the mainland of the coastal areas of Quang Tri and Thua Thien Hue.

Also on the night of September 18 and early morning of September 19, increased rainfall in Thua Thien Hue province caused some roads to be flooded. To proactively respond, many people raised their belongings and cars to high, safe places to avoid damage.

Previously, households living in areas at risk of landslides were also evacuated to safety by local authorities. At noon on September 18, the Border Guard Command of Thua Thien Hue province called for 1,884 vehicles/10,685 workers, all boats had entered safe anchorage (100%). Fishing boats from other provinces had entered anchorage: 23 vehicles/194 workers.

2 coastal districts in Quang Tri let students stay home to avoid storm

On the morning of September 19, the Department of Education and Training of Quang Tri province confirmed that on the evening of September 18, it had sent a document to units about proactively responding to storm No. 4.

Accordingly, the Department of Education and Training of Quang Tri province requires heads of units and schools to proactively let students take time off from school depending on the developments of tropical depressions and storms in each area.

After this directive, Lao Dong Newspaper noted that in the early morning of September 19, some localities and schools have allowed students to stay home from school. In particular, Vinh Linh and Gio Linh districts have allowed all students to stay home from school since the morning of the same day.

The remaining localities require schools to review and proactively let students stay home from school if there is heavy rain in low-lying areas. For example, in Dong Ha city, some schools proactively let students stay home from the morning of September 19.

In addition to allowing students to stay home from school, schools are proactively reviewing and checking facilities, especially classrooms, functional rooms, roofs, drainage systems, etc. to ensure safety against storms. In addition, they are preparing evacuation plans to move students, teachers, teaching materials and equipment to safe places.

According to the Quang Tri Province Hydrometeorological Station, in the early morning of September 19, the tropical depression in the northeastern area of ​​Hoang Sa archipelago strengthened into a storm, storm number 4.2024.

The center of the storm at 7:00 a.m. on September 19 was approximately 17.5 degrees North latitude; 108.7 degrees East longitude, approximately 165km East Northeast of Quang Tri.

The strongest wind is level 8 (62-74km/h), gusting to level 10. At Con Co island in Quang Tri province, the wind is level 7, gusting to level 8. At Cua Viet town, the wind is level 4-5, gusting to level 6.

Warning of heavy rain from morning to night of September 19. From the morning of September 19, coastal areas will be directly affected by strong winds, after which the strong winds will gradually increase inland. There is a high risk of flash floods and landslides in mountainous areas, flooding in low-lying areas and in Dong Ha City.
